Anne's Arrival and Initial Impression
As episode 2 kicks off, we find Anne still adjusting to life at Green Gables. Having just arrived, she's trying to settle into her new life with Marilla and Matthew Cuthbert. While the first episode set the stage for Anne's arrival, this one really plunges us into her daily life and the unique dynamics within the Cuthbert household. Anne's vivid imagination is immediately apparent as she describes her room in glowing terms, transforming a simple space into a haven of beauty and fantasy. This early interaction with her surroundings highlights her ability to find wonder and beauty in the mundane, a crucial aspect of her character. We also see her initial interactions with Marilla and Matthew deepening, revealing the contrasting personalities that will define much of their relationship. Marilla, pragmatic and reserved, struggles to understand Anne's romanticism and often clashes with the young girl's exuberant nature. Matthew, on the other hand, is captivated by Anne's charm and quick wit, creating a bond based on silent understanding and affection. Their differing approaches to parenting or guiding Anne set the stage for various comical and touching moments. We see how Anne's feelings are a mix of excitement, hope, and a lingering fear of rejection, hinting at her past experiences and the emotional baggage she carries. The episode carefully balances these internal struggles with moments of joy and wonder, particularly when Anne connects with the natural world around Green Gables. She finds solace in the beauty of the landscape, personifying trees and flowers, and creating stories from the most ordinary scenes. The picturesque surroundings of Avonlea become an extension of her imagination. This ability to see the extraordinary in the ordinary is one of the most endearing qualities that draw viewers to Anne.

The Relationship Between Anne and Marilla
Throughout the episode, the relationship between Anne and Marilla develops, albeit with its fair share of bumps. Marilla, a woman of practicality and routine, struggles to understand Anne's flights of fancy and often finds herself exasperated by her. There are moments of friction as Marilla tries to instill order in Anne's life, and Anne, in turn, resists, longing for understanding and acceptance. However, beneath the surface of their conflicts, a mutual respect and a growing affection begin to emerge. Marilla begins to see Anne's potential and her capacity for warmth and kindness, while Anne starts to recognize Marilla's underlying care and devotion, even if it is not always expressed in the ways she expects. The interactions between these two are often the most heartwarming. Marilla's tough love approach gradually gives way to understanding and support, which becomes a slow journey toward bonding. These interactions highlight the importance of patience, understanding, and open communication in building relationships. It also shows the importance of seeing beyond first impressions and recognizing the value of those who seem different from us. Their evolving dynamic forms the emotional core of the series, showing the profound impact that love, acceptance, and understanding have in building a close bond.
